A team from Northern Robotics Laboratory (Norlab) at Laval University in Quebec - who recently won best paper at this year's computer and robot vision conference - is pushing robotic navigation to its absolute limits: autonomous navigation in the snow! The team has recruited a Warthog UGV to help with developing and testing navigation algorithms designed for unstructured terrains in challenging dynamic winter conditions. Their robot is equipped with a variety of sensors including several Robosense LiDARs, an Xsens IMU, GNSS and a dedicated computer.
